2015-01-27 7 views
6

को एमएमएपी करने में असफ़ल मैं अपने ओएस एक्स सर्वर 4.0 पर एक्सकोड बॉट को एकीकृत करने का प्रयास करते समय इस "बिल्ड सर्विस त्रुटि समस्याओं को ठीक करने" के बारे में अनजान हूं।एक्सकोड बॉट एकीकरण त्रुटि:

सब कुछ इस सर्वर पर ठीक काम करता है, मेरे पास एक ही परियोजना की दूसरी शाखा पर एक और कामकाजी बॉट भी है।

यह मुझे फेंकता

बॉट मुद्दा: त्रुटि। सेवा त्रुटि बनाएँ। समस्या: mmap करने में विफल। डेटा नहीं लिख सकता: अमान्य तर्क (-1)।

पता नहीं कि क्या करना है ...

अग्रिम धन्यवाद मिल गया!

उत्तर

0

मेरे पास एक ही समस्या थी और मैंने बस इसे ठीक करने के लिए कोई भी बदलाव किए बिना बॉट को अपडेट किया। बस एक्सकोड में नेविगेटर की रिपोर्ट करें, अपना बॉट चुनें, "बॉट संपादित करें ..." दबाएं और बिना किसी बदलाव किए इसे अपडेट करें।

+0

Fwiw, बस "अभी एकीकृत ..." कर सही होने के बाद यह काम करने लगता है। उम्मीद है कि ऐप्पल जल्द ही इस पर पहुंच जाएगा (डालें "क्या आपने इसे बंद करने और चालू करने की कोशिश की है?" उद्धरण)। –

4

यह स्पष्ट रूप से due to a bug in Xcode 6.1.1 है। कामकाज करने के लिए, मैंने Xcode 6.1 को पुनर्स्थापित किया।

मैं सिर्फ सर्वर अनुप्रयोग में Xcode का एक और संस्करण का चयन करने में सक्षम नहीं था, मैं पूरी तरह से Xcode सेवा रीसेट करने के लिए किया था (यह आपके सभी बोट्स को नष्ट करेगा, तो आप उन्हें फिर से बनाना होगा):

sudo xcrun xcscontrol --reset 

इससे पहले कि मैं मैं भी इस आदेश को चलाने के लिए किया था सर्वर अनुप्रयोग में Xcode 6.1 चुन सकते हैं:

sudo xcrun xcscontrol --initialize 

कोई बहुत साहसी लगता है और Xcode 6.1.1 पर समस्या के मूल कारण को समझने के लिए चाहते हैं, तो मैं यहाँ एस error से आता है। Libgit2 बाइनरी /Xcode-6.1.1.app/Contents/Developer/usr/lib/libgit2.dylib

+0

बहुत बहुत धन्यवाद! इसे आशंका देने की कोशिश करेगा और आपको बताएगा। – olirip

+0

यह मेरे लिए एक्सकोड 6.2 में भी होता है। क्या यह आपके साथ होता है? –

+0

6.3 और 6.4 में एक ही समस्या है –

0

संस्करण 6.3 (संभवतः पहले) के अनुसार, एक्सकोड अब एक "इसे ठीक करें" बटन प्रदान करता है जो गिट प्रमाण-पत्र को ठीक करता है, और मुझे ऊपर चलाकर चलाता है। अगले निर्माण में कामकाजी प्रतिलिपि राज्य के बारे में चेतावनी थी, लेकिन सफाई के बाद, अगला निर्माण ठीक था।

0

मेरे पास इस मुद्दे के लिए एक बहुत ही ठोस समाधान था। अभी भी यह सुनिश्चित नहीं है कि इस मुद्दे का क्या कारण है लेकिन यह मेरे लिए मौलिक रूप से विफल रहा था। मैंने जो किया वह हमेशा साफ सेट के साथ एकीकृत था जब तक कि मुझे एक सफल परीक्षण नहीं मिला, उस बिंदु पर मैंने कभी भी साफ करने के लिए बॉट संपादित नहीं किया। अब यह हर बार परीक्षण सफलतापूर्वक चल रहा है। मैं यह नहीं कह रहा हूँ कि यह सही समाधान है और मुझे पता है कि यह एक अच्छा समाधान नहीं है, लेकिन OSX सर्वर को रीसेट और मेरे ssh कुंजी आदि इसके लिए एक ही रास्ता अद्यतन करने मैं इसे चारों ओर हो सकता है की कोशिश की थी।

संबंधित मुद्दे